Blue Cheese Peach Pizza with Honey

Ingredients

Scale

3 tablespoons olive oil

1 clove garlic, sliced in half lengthwise

1 store-bought or homemade pizza dough

1 large, just-ripe peach

6 ounces mozzarella cheese

1 to 2 ounces blue cheese

1 to 2 tablespoons honey, for serving

2 to 3 tablespoons julienned basil, for serving

Chili Flakes or Pickled Jalapenos

Instructions

  1. Heat your oven to 475˚F with a pizza stone. Heat olive oil in a small skillet. Add the garlic and fry until the garlic is golden. Remove from heat and let rest until ready to use. Before using, remove garlic.
  2. Prepare the pizza topping. Thinly slice the peaches and grate the mozzarella cheese.
  3. On a good non-stick surface (like a pizza peel sprinkled with cornmeal), stretch and roll the dough into a circle roughly 12 to 14” in size. Spread the garlic-infused olive oil over the pizza dough then layer with the thinly sliced peaches, grated mozzarella cheese, and crumbled blue cheese.
  4. Transfer the pizza to a pizza stone and bake until the cheese has melted and the crust is golden.
  5. Remove the pizza from the oven and drizzle with honey and sprinkle with julienned basil.
